The assassin and the slanderer differ only in the weapon they use;
with the one it is the dagger, with the other the tongue.
The latter is worse than the former, for the first only kills the body,
while the other murders the reputation
--Tyron Edwards
Associate yourself with men of good quality if you esteem
your own reputation; for 'tis better to be alone than in bad company.
--George Washington
Your reputation is in the hands of others. That's what a reputation is.
You can't control that. The only thing you can control is your character.
--Dr. Wayne W. Dyer
Many a man's reputation would not know his character if they met on the street.
--Elbert Hubbard

Be more concerned with your character than your reputation,
because your character is what you really are; your reputation
is merely what others think you are.
--John Wooden Hall of Fame Basketball coach
You need only reflect that one of the best ways to get yourself
a reputation as a dangerous citizen these days is to go about
repeating the very phrases which our founding fathers
used in the struggle for independence.
--Charles A. Beard
